Warum ist exe so gross?
-
hi,
habe nicht mal viel sachen drin und trotzdem ist exe so verdammt gross .. wozu sind überhaupt die packages gut? wenn ich das prog anderem geben will kann derjenige es nicht ausführen weil dateien fehlen .. gebe ich sie ihm kann ich ja fast ne cd mit den ganzen dlls etc vollpacken.
die guten vc++ sachen sind schön klein .. die cbiulder immer gigantisch.
gibt es irgendwelche compiler tricks?-ich deaktiviere packages
-mach compiler "engültige version"
-und muss bei Linker -> "dynamische RTL verwenden" deaktiveren da sonst immer DLLs fehlen bei anderen.kann jemand nem anfänger diesbezüglich nen tipp geben?
-
anfängers schrieb:
die guten vc++ sachen sind schön klein .. die cbiulder immer gigantisch.
Jo, aber auch nur,wennman die MFC nicht statisch linkt...
-junix
-
Mit anderen Worten: Microsoft drückt dir ungefragt seine ganzen Runtime-DLLs mit dem Betriebssystem auf's Auge, das kann Borland logischerweise nicht. Deshalb musst du mehr Code mitliefern, entweder in der Exe oder als zusätzliche DLLs.
-
Gibt es eigentlich bei Borland auf der Homepage auch so einen Runtime-Libraries-Installer wie bei Visual Basic? Da kann man ja bei www.microsoft.de ein Installationspackage runter laden.
Phips
-
versuch ma PECompact
das macht dir die exe noch bissl dünner
-
Oder besser UPX. Das is nämlich im Gegensatz zu PECompact kostenlos.
Phips